A catastrophic injury is not merely a severe wound; it’s a life-altering event that results in permanent impairment, disability, or disfigurement. These injuries demand extensive medical treatment, rehabilitation, and ongoing care, often for the remainder of your life. The consequences extend far beyond physical pain, encompassing emotional distress, loss of earning capacity, and a diminished ability to enjoy life’s simple pleasures.
Defining Catastrophic Injuries
Your understanding of what constitutes a catastrophic injury is crucial when seeking legal representation. These injuries are characterized by their severity and their long-lasting impact.
Spinal Cord Injuries
Damage to the spinal cord can lead to paralysis, affecting your ability to move and function. The extent of the injury, whether complete or incomplete, dictates the degree of functional loss and the necessary lifelong support.
Traumatic Brain Injuries (TBIs)
A TBI can result from a sudden blow or jolt to the head, causing brain damage. The effects can range from mild cognitive impairment to severe disabilities affecting memory, motor skills, and personality.
Severe Burns
Extensive burns can lead to disfigurement, chronic pain, and significant mobility issues. The skin’s crucial role in protection, temperature regulation, and sensation is permanently compromised.
Amputations
The loss of a limb, whether due to trauma or medical necessity following an accident, necessitates extensive adaptation and often requires prosthetics and ongoing therapy. The psychological impact of amputation is also a significant consideration.
Multiple Fractures and Crush Injuries
When multiple bones are fractured or an entire body part is severely crushed, the road to recovery is often long and arduous, potentially leading to permanent limitations in movement and function.
The Scope of Long-Term Recovery Needs
Your recovery is not a finite process with a clear endpoint. For catastrophic injuries, long-term recovery encompasses a multifaceted approach to restoring as much independence and quality of life as possible.
Medical Treatment and Rehabilitation
This includes surgeries, physical therapy, occupational therapy, speech therapy, and psychological counseling. The duration and intensity are dictated by the specific injury.
Assistive Devices and Home Modifications
You may require wheelchairs, walkers, custom-designed homes, or modifications to your existing living space to accommodate your needs and enhance your independence.
Ongoing Medical Care and Medications
Many catastrophic injuries require lifelong medication, regular doctor’s visits, and potentially specialized medical interventions that will continue for years.
Lost Earning Capacity
The inability to continue in your previous employment or any gainful occupation due to your injury directly impacts your financial well-being and requires compensation for these future losses.
Pain Management and Mental Health Support
Chronic pain and the emotional toll of a catastrophic injury are significant concerns that require dedicated management and therapeutic intervention.

The Role of a Catastrophic Injury Lawyer in Securing Your Future
A skilled catastrophic injury lawyer in Westridge, McKinney, does more than just file paperwork. They are your advocate, your strategist, and your guide through a complex and often overwhelming legal and medical system.
Investigating the Incident Thoroughly
The foundation of any strong personal injury claim lies in a meticulous investigation of how the injury occurred.
Gathering Evidence
This involves collecting all relevant documents, photographs, videos, and witness statements that can illuminate the circumstances of the accident.
Identifying Liable Parties
Your lawyer will work to pinpoint every entity or individual responsible for causing your injury, which may include drivers, property owners, manufacturers, or employers.
Engaging Expert Witnesses
For catastrophic injury cases, expert testimony is crucial. This can include accident reconstructionists, vocational experts, and economists.
Building a Comprehensive Damages Case
Quantifying the full extent of your losses is a complex undertaking, especially when future needs are involved.
Documenting Medical Expenses
This includes past, present, and future medical bills, including surgeries, therapies, medications, and any necessary equipment.
Calculating Lost Wages and Earning Capacity
Your lawyer will assess your current and future income potential, considering your injury’s impact on your ability to work.
Valuing Non-Economic Damages
This encompasses compensation for pain and suffering, emotional distress, loss of enjoyment of life, and disfigurement.
Negotiating with Insurance Companies
Insurance adjusters are often skilled negotiators whose primary goal is to minimize payouts. Your lawyer acts as a buffer and a strong negotiator on your behalf.
Understanding Insurance Tactics
Your attorney will recognize and counter common insurance company strategies designed to reduce claim values.
Fierce Advocacy for Fair Compensation
Your lawyer will fight to ensure you receive fair compensation that adequately covers all your damages.

Initial Consultation and Attorney Evaluation
The first step is to meet with potential attorneys to assess their suitability for your case.
Questions to Ask Potential Lawyers
Prepare a list of questions regarding their experience with similar cases, their legal strategies, their fee structure, and their communication protocols.
Assessing Their Understanding of Your Case
During the consultation, observe how well the attorney listens to your story and demonstrates an understanding of the unique complexities of your injury and its impact.
Reviewing Their Credentials and Reputation
Research the attorney’s bar association status, any disciplinary actions, and their overall reputation within the legal community and among their former clients.
Understanding the Fee Structure
Personal injury lawyers typically work on a contingency fee basis, meaning they are paid a percentage of the settlement or verdict they obtain for you.
Contingency Fee Agreements Explained
Ensure you fully understand the percentage, when it is applied, and what expenses you might be responsible for if the case is unsuccessful.
Transparency Regarding Costs
The best attorneys will be upfront and transparent about all potential costs associated with your case, including expert witness fees and court costs.
